一种基于即时通信的视频通信建立方法

文档序号:7629721阅读:152来源:国知局
专利名称:一种基于即时通信的视频通信建立方法
技术领域
本发明涉及即时通信(IM,Instant Messenger)技术,特别涉及到一种基于IM的视频通信建立方法。
背景技术
随着因特网(Internet)使用的普及和技术的不断成熟,在Internet上进行语音和/或视频的交流及沟通已成为可能,可以进行语音和/或视频通信的IM工具也越来越受到广大用户的青睐,例如,腾讯公司推出的QQ IM工具或微软公司推出的MSN IM工具等等。
目前,在使用典型的IM工具进行视频通信的过程中,用户在进行视频通信之前,首先要发送一个视频连接请求到进行视频通信的对端用户,询问对方是否愿意进行视频通信,如果对方接受该视频连接请求,则开始视频通信双方的视频连接过程,视频通道建立后就可以进行视频通信了;如果对方不接受该视频连接请求,则不进行视频通信双方的视频连接过程。
根据不完全统计,在目前视频通信应用中,被对端用户直接拒绝的视频连接请求数占视频连接请求总数的30%左右,因此,如何激发用户进行视频通信兴趣,降低用户拒绝视频连接请求的比例是推动视频通信发展需要解决的问题之一。

发明内容
为了解决上述技术问题,本发明提供了一种基于IM的视频通信建立方法,可以激发用户进行视频通信兴趣,有效降低用户拒绝视频连接请求的比例。
本发明所述基于即时通信的视频通信建立方法,主要包括
A、在请求方发送视频连接请求时,启动请求方的视频摄像设备,捕获当前的视频画面,并对所捕获的视频画面进行处理,形成请求方的图像文件;B、将形成的图像文件承载于请求方发送的视频连接请求中,发送到视频连接请求的被请求方;C、所述被请求方接收到所述视频连接请求后,对该视频连接请求携带的图像文件进行处理,将处理后的图像显示在所述被请求方即时通信窗口中,并在所述被请求方接受当前的视频连接请求后,在所述请求方和被请求方之间建立视频连接。
步骤A所述对所捕获的视频画面进行处理,包括A1、将视频画面缩小到视频连接请求被请求方即时通信窗口可以容纳的适合的大小;A2、使用图片压缩技术对减小到适合大小的视频画面进行压缩,得到所述请求方的图像文件。
步骤A1所述适合大小为80×60象素。
步骤A2所述压缩采用联合图像专家组压缩方法;所述图像文件为JPG文件。
步骤A2所述压缩采用位图压缩方法;所述图像文件为位图BMP文件。
步骤A2所述压缩采用可移植的网络图像压缩方法;所述图像文件为可移植的网络图像格式PNG文件。
步骤A2所述压缩采用标签图像压缩方法;所述图像文件为标签图像文件格式TIFF文件。
步骤C所述对视频连接请求携带的图像文件进行处理为采用与步骤A2所述压缩方法对应的解压缩方法对所述图像文件进行解压缩。
步骤B所述将形成的图像文件承载于请求方发送的视频连接请求中包括使用扩展的视频连接请求承载所述图像文件。
本发明所述扩展的视频连接请求包括表示邀请对方建立通信请求的命令字、被请求方的标识、通信请求的类型、所述图像文件的长度、以及所述图像文件数据。
由此可以看出,在这种新的视频通信建立方式下,由于视频连接请求的被请求方可以预先看到请求方的图像信息,使他可以获得更多有关请求方的信息进行参考,从而可以激发他与请求方进行视频通信欲望,大大增加被请求方接受视频连接请求的比例。


图1为本发明所述的基于IM的视频通信建立方法流程图;图2为被请求方接收到请求方的视频连接请求后被请求方用户IM工具窗口中显示的画面。
具体实施例方式
为使发明的目的、技术方案及优点更加清楚明白,以下参照附图并举实施例,对本发明作进一步详细说明。
考虑到在现有基于IM工具的视频连接请求过程中,视频通信的被请求方通常仅能够获得请求方的昵称,而无法获得其他更丰富的、有关该请求方的信息供其参考,使被请求方无法更进一步了解请求方的实际情况,往往会直接导致拒绝视频连接请求情况的发生。因此,如果能够在视频连接请求中提供给被请求方更丰富的有关请求方的信息,就可以增大视频通信的请求方对被请求方的吸引力,从而增加被请求方接受视频连接请求的比例。
基于上述思想,本发明给出了一种基于IM的视频通信建立方法,该方法在请求方发送视频连接请求的同时,将当前捕获的请求方图像信息,也就是请求方的快照发送给被请求方,供被请求方参考,从而增加发起视频连接请求的请求方对被请求方的吸引力。
本发明所述的基于IM的视频通信建立方法如图1所示,主要包括以下步骤A、在请求方发送视频连接请求时,请求方IM工具启动请求方的视频摄像设备,捕获当前的视频画面。
在这里所述的视频摄像设备可以是摄像头。
B、对步骤A所捕获的视频画面进行处理,形成请求方的图像文件。
在本步骤中,所述对视频画面进行处理主要包括B1、将视频画面缩小到被请求方IM工具通信窗口,即被请求方即时通信窗口可以容纳的适合的大小,例如80×60(象素);B2、使用现有的图片压缩技术对减小到适合大小的视频画面进行压缩,得到所述请求方的图像文件。
在本步骤B2中,可以使用多种图像压缩技术,例如使用联合图像专家组(JPEG)压缩技术、JPEG2000压缩技术、可移植的网络图像文件压缩技术以及标签图像压缩技术等等对视频画面进行压缩。由此,根据所使用图像压缩技术的不同,所生成的请求方的图像文件也可以是多种文件类型的,例如可以是JPG图像文件、可移植的网络图像文件格式(PNG)文件、标签图像文件格式(TIFF)文件或位图(BMP)文件等等。
C、请求方IM工具将形成的图像文件承载于请求方发送的视频连接请求中,与所述视频连接请求一起发送到所述被请求方。
在该步骤中,需要对现有的视频连接请求进行扩展以承载请求方的图像文件。以腾讯公司的QQ IM工具为例,在现有不传输请求方图像文件时,所述视频连接请求为INVITE 8000967 VIDEO CHAT,其中,INVITE为表示邀请建立通信请求的命令字,8000967为被请求方的标识,即被请求方的QQ号码,VIDEO CHAT为通信请求的类型是视频聊天。在本发明所述的优选实施例中,有请求方图像文件需要传输时,可以将上述视频连接请求扩展为INVITE 8000967 VIDEO CHAT THUMB<图像文件长度><图像文件数据>,其中,THUMB为图像文件的大小标示。
D、被请求方的IM工具接收到所述视频连接请求后,对该视频连接请求中携带的图像文件进行处理,并显示在被请求方IM工具的通信窗口中。
在该步骤中,所述处理包括对应步骤B2采用的压缩技术,使用相应的图像解压缩技术对所述图像文件进行解压缩。例如若步骤B2采用JPEG技术进行图像压缩,则在本步骤也采用JPEG技术进行图像文件的解压缩。
经过上述处理后,被请求方IM工具的通信窗口,即被请求方即时通信窗口内显示的画面将如图2所示。
E、在被请求方选择接受当前的视频连接请求后,视频通信的请求方和被请求方之间建立视频连接,进行视频通信。
在本步骤中,可以采用现有的方法建立所述视频连接,并且,所述视频通信的请求方以及被请求方之间的视频通信过程也可以采用与现有视频通信相同的方法。
由图1所示的处理过程以及图2显示的窗口画面可以看出,在这种新的视频通信建立方式下,由于被请求方可以看到包含请求方影像的图像,即请求方的快照,因此他可以获得更多有关请求方的信息,从而可以激发他的视频通信欲望,增大他接受视频连接请求的比例。
权利要求
1.一种基于即时通信的视频通信建立方法,其特征在于,所述方法包括A、在请求方发送视频连接请求时,启动请求方的视频摄像设备,捕获当前的视频画面,并对所捕获的视频画面进行处理,形成请求方的图像文件;B、将形成的图像文件承载于请求方发送的视频连接请求中,发送到视频连接请求的被请求方;C、所述被请求方接收到所述视频连接请求后,对该视频连接请求携带的图像文件进行处理,将处理后的图像显示在所述被请求方即时通信窗口中,并在所述被请求方接受当前的视频连接请求后,在所述请求方和被请求方之间建立视频连接。
2.如权利要求1所述的方法,其特征在于,步骤A所述对所捕获的视频画面进行处理包括A1、将视频画面缩小到视频连接请求被请求方即时通信窗口可以容纳的适合的大小;A2、使用图片压缩技术对减小到适合大小的视频画面进行压缩,得到所述请求方的图像文件。
3.如权利要求2所述的方法,其特征在于,步骤A1所述适合大小为80×60象素。
4.如权利要求2所述的方法,其特征在于,步骤A2所述压缩采用联合图像专家组压缩方法;所述图像文件为JPG文件。
5.如权利要求2所述的方法,其特征在于,步骤A2所述压缩采用位图压缩方法;所述图像文件为位图BMP文件。
6.如权利要求2所述的方法,其特征在于,步骤A2所述压缩采用可移植的网络图像压缩方法;所述图像文件为可移植的网络图像格式PNG文件。
7.如权利要求2所述的方法,其特征在于,步骤A2所述压缩采用标签图像压缩方法;所述图像文件为标签图像文件格式TIFF文件。
8.如权利要求2所述的方法,其特征在于,步骤C所述对视频连接请求携带的图像文件进行处理为采用与步骤A2所述压缩方法对应的解压缩方法对所述图像文件进行解压缩。
9.如权利要求1所述的方法,其特征在于,步骤B所述将形成的图像文件承载于请求方发送的视频连接请求中包括使用扩展的视频连接请求承载所述图像文件。
10.如权利要求7所述的方法,其特征在于,所述扩展的视频连接请求包括表示邀请对方建立通信请求的命令字、被请求方的标识、通信请求的类型、所述图像文件的长度、以及所述图像文件数据。
全文摘要
本发明公开了一种基于即时通信的视频通信建立方法,包括在请求方发送视频连接请求时,启动请求方的视频摄像设备,捕获当前的视频画面,并对所捕获的视频画面进行处理,形成请求方的图像文件;将形成的图像文件承载于请求方发送的视频连接请求中,发送到视频连接请求的被请求方;所述被请求方接收到所述视频连接请求后,对该视频连接请求携带的图像文件进行处理,将处理后的图像显示在所述被请求方即时通信窗口中,并在所述被请求方接受当前的视频连接请求后,在所述请求方和被请求方之间建立视频连接。该方法可以为视频通信的被请求方提供更多有关请求方的信息,激发他进行视频通信欲望,增加他接受视频连接请求的比例。
文档编号H04L12/58GK1988648SQ20051013509
公开日2007年6月27日 申请日期2005年12月23日 优先权日2005年12月23日
发明者梁柱, 张宝和 申请人:腾讯科技(深圳)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1